Output d7b20d9a011b2b91ac13cd467b5ef26d4b79136a0cd1f13f849b23a3aa0dca14: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4720462a2e2d2afc1bca5f63ba4d18a27c673810 OP_EQUALVERIFY OP_CHECKSIG
address
17V5e4d1bwVFiNFrXKKZGnmjwgUSeDavjk
transaction
d7b20d9a011b2b91ac13cd467b5ef26d4b79136a0cd1f13f849b23a3aa0dca14
confirmations
525628
spent
true